Reconstructing the Significance of the Dalseong Ruins in Daegu
Lee Narae,김연희 차세대컨버전스정보서비스학회 2022 Journal of Digital Media & Culture Technology Vol.2 No.1
Daegu Dalseong Ruins, an ancient tomb complex, has sufferedthe effects of urban development and resulted in the lossalteration of many tombs. While previous excavations have focused on the tombs, research on the Dalseong fortress has been limited. In this regard, the purpose of this study is to emphasize the importance of a meticulous examination of local historical resources to authenticate the true essence of Dalseong and shed light on its historical context and cultural significance. The study examines the geographical location, the archaeological remains and the historical and cultural significance of these ruins. Through careful analysis, the study aims to contribute to a deeper understanding of the cultural, historical and social dimensions encapsulated within the Daegu Dalseong Ruins.
Intriguing Indium-salen Complexes as Multicolor Luminophores
Lee, Seon Hee,Shin, Nara,Kwak, Sang Woo,Hyun, Kyunglim,Woo, Won Hee,Lee, Ji Hye,Hwang, Hyonseok,Kim, Min,Lee, Junseong,Kim, Youngjo,Lee, Kang Mun,Park, Myung Hwan American Chemical Society 2017 Inorganic Chemistry Vol.56 No.5
<P>The series of novel salen-based indium complexes (3-Bu-t-S-R-salen)In-Me (3-Bu-t-S-R-salen = N,N'-bis(2-oxy-3-tert-butyl-S-R-salicylidene)-1,2-diarninoethane, R = H (1), Bu-t (2), Br (3), Ph (4), OMe (5), NMe2 (6)) and [(3-Bu-t-5-NMe3-salen)In-Me] (OTO)(2) (7; OTf = CF3SO3-) have been synthesized and fully characterized by NMR spectroscopy and elemental analysis. All indium complexes 1-7 are highly stable in air and even aqueous solutions. The solid-state structures for 3-5, which were confirmed by single-crystal X-ray analysis, exhibit square-pyramidal geometries around the indium center. Both the UV/vis absorption and PL spectra of 1-7 exhibit significant intramolecular charge transfer (ICT) transitions based on the salen moieties with systematically bathochromic shifts, which depend on the introduction of various kinds of substituents. Consequently, the emission spectra of these complexes cover almost the entire-visible region lambda(em)= 455-622 run).</P>

A neonate with Joubert syndrome presenting with symptoms of Horner syndrome
Lee, Narae,Nam, Sang-Ook,Kim, Young Mi,Lee, Yun-Jin The Korean Pediatric Society 2016 Clinical and Experimental Pediatrics (CEP) Vol.59 No.no.sup1
Joubert syndrome (JS) is characterized by the "molar tooth sign" (MTS) with cerebellar vermis agenesis, episodic hyperpnea, abnormal eye movements, and hypotonia. Ocular and oculomotor abnormalities have been observed; however, Horner syndrome (HS) has not been documented in children with JS. We present the case of a 2-month-old boy having ocular abnormalities with bilateral nystagmus, left-dominant bilateral ptosis, and unilateral miosis and enophthalmos of the left eye, which were compatible with HS. Brain mag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) revealed the presence of the MTS. Neck MRI showed no definite lesion or mass around the cervical sympathetic chain. His global development was delayed. He underwent ophthalmologic surgery, and showed some improvement in his ptosis. To the best of our knowledge, the association of HS with JS has not yet been described. We suggest that early neuroimaging should be considered for neonates or young infants with diverse eye abnormalities to evaluate the underlying etiology.

<P>Symbiotic stars are regarded as wide binary systems consisting of a hot white dwarf and a mass losing giant. They exhibit unique spectral features at 6825 and 7082 angstrom, which are formed via Raman scattering of O VI lambda lambda 1032 and 1038 with atomic hydrogen. We adopt a Monte Carlo technique to generate the same number of O VI lambda 1032 and lambda 1038 line photons and compute the flux ratioF(6825)/F(7082) of these Raman scattered O VI features formed in neutral regions with a simple geometric shape as a function of H I column density N-H I. In cylindrical and spherical neutral regions with the O VI source embedded inside, the flux ratioF(6825)/F(7082) shows an overall decrease from 3 to 1 as N-H I increases in the range 10(22-24) cm(-2). In cases of slab geometry and other geometries with the O VI source outside the H I region, Rayleigh escape operates to lower the flux ratio considerably. For moderate values of N-H I similar to 10(23) cm(-2) the flux ratio behaves in a complicated way to exhibit a broad bump with a peak value of 3.5 in the case of a sphere geometry. We find that the ratio of Raman conversion efficiencies of O VI lambda lambda 1032, 1038 ranges from 0.8 to 3.5. Our high resolution spectra of ' D' type HM Sge and 'S' type AG. Dra obtained with the Canada-France-Hawaii Telescope show that the flux ratioF(6825)/F(7082) of AG. Dra is significantly smaller than that of HM Sge, implying that 'S' type symbiotics are characterized by higher N-H I than ' D' type symbiotics.</P>
